Okay, I'm not sure whether this ought to be here or in the Studio forum.

XTransfer is out, and I've got it working for DAZ O and PA  characters. Now I need to move a handful of my own dial-spins. Obviously there can be no transfer until I can get them into a format that gives me a single dial to spin. These are G3 characters and use no GenX2 morphs, just DAZ O and PA morphs, with 3DU's Toon Generations 2 prominently featured.

Ideally I would like to be able to split the head and body morphs into separate dials, but if that's not readily doable, I can happily live with a single character dial.

So. What are the necessary steps?

    If you want it as a master character dial, Go into edit mode, Create a new property, ERC freeze that property dialed up with all your morphs dialed. Now save that property when at 0. Now when you dial it all your chosen morphs dial along with it.
